Spring Security中的OAuth2如何支持不同类型的令牌授予方式

发布时间:2024-06-04 17:30:04 作者:小樊
来源:亿速云 阅读:107

Spring Security中的OAuth2支持多种不同类型的令牌授予方式,包括以下几种:

  1. 基于授权码的授权方式(authorization code grant):通过重定向用户浏览器来获取授权码,然后通过授权码换取访问令牌。

  2. 基于密码的授权方式(password grant):用户直接提供用户名和密码来获取访问令牌。

  3. 基于客户端凭证的授权方式(client credentials grant):客户端使用自己的凭证来获取访问令牌,无需用户参与。

  4. 基于刷新令牌的授权方式(refresh token grant):使用刷新令牌来获取新的访问令牌,以实现令牌的刷新功能。

Spring Security提供了相应的配置类和接口来支持不同类型的令牌授予方式,开发者可以根据自己的需求选择合适的授权方式来实现OAuth2认证和授权功能。

推荐阅读:
  1. Spring Boot Security OAuth2 实现支持JWT令牌的授权服务器
  2. Spring Security OAuth2实现登录互踢的方法

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

spring

上一篇:如何使用Spring Cloud Stream处理消息流

下一篇:如何在Spring Boot中管理和运用环境配置文件

相关阅读

您好,登录后才能下订单哦!

密码登录
登录注册
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》